ROG Strix Scar 17 SE and Flow X16 Release Date and Price
Asus tell me the Strix Scar 17 SE will embark on at $ 3,499 and go up to $ 3,699 . The Flow X16 will be $ 1,949 and can be configure for up to $ 2,699 . I was n’t hand any release dates , only that the Strix Scar 17 SE will be available first , and that neither example will be readily usable when they launch .

With the Scar 17 SE , you at least get a wide array of ports , including a USB 3.1 Type - C input , a Thunderbolt 4 port , two USB - A ports , an RJ45 Ethernet jack , an HDMI 2.1b , and a headphone jack .
understandably seeable is the Strix Scar 17 SE ’s performance potential . It comes fit out with 12th GenIntel Core i9 HX - series CPUs with up to 16 coresand up to a 65W TDP paired with up to an Nvidia GeForce RTX 3080 Ti GPU boosted to a 175W power envelope . You wo n’t be throttled by the other factor , either , as the Scar indorse up to 64 GB of DDR5 RAM and up to dual 2 TB SSDs . Asus promises the simple machine will function 15 degrees cool than the previous model .
make for competitive gamers , the Scar 17 SE sport the fastest displays , let in a 17 - inch , 1080p at 360Hz gore or a 1440p ( QHD ) at 240Hz pick . Both IPS panels have a 3 - millisecond response prison term and patronize Adaptive Sync . We have n’t invite any runtime estates , but the 90Wh battery in the Scar will appoint from 0 % to 50 % in just 30 minutes .

ROG Flow X16
The third member of the Flow family , the Flow X16 , is a 16 - column inch transformable gaming laptop that can be paired to Asus ’ proprietary XG Mobile eGPU . It tamp down an AMD Ryzen 9 6900HS CPU and RTX 3070 Ti GPU paired with up to 64 GB of DDR5 RAM and up to a 2 TB SSD . It ’s enough desirableness for all but the most demanding gamers .

Where I ca n’t ascertain fracture is with the presentation . It ’s a 16 - column inch , 2560 × 1440 ( QHD ) resolution venire with a 16:10 aspect ratio and up to 1,100 nits . Asus says the sieve covers 100 % of the DCI - P3 color gamut , so expect springy chromaticity . Better yet , the covert has a 165Hz refresh rate , which will make fast - moving telecasting and games flow swimmingly .
